British Labour MP Sarah Champion said that Gazans were being “increasingly abandoned”. “Politicians around the world need to demand an immediate end to the violence, full access to aid, and a long-term strategy to rebuild Gaza; both its infrastructure and its society,” she said after a trip to Rafah this week. “Listening to seasoned humanitarians tell us that what they’ve witnessed in Gaza makes it the worst disaster they’ve ever seen. Aid workers repeatedly questioned why international law wasn’t being followed or upheld in relation to civilians, humanitarians and medics,” he added.
